For smaller deployments (up to a few machines), you can also obtain an installer from your Microsoft account portal. After logging into setup.office.com and entering your product key, you are often presented with an option to install Office. This method downloads a small bootstrapper file ( SetupProd_OfficeInstall.exe ). While this file itself is a verified executable signed by Microsoft, it is not an offline ISO; it still requires an internet connection to function.

The confusion often arises because Microsoft does provide ISO files for some volume licensing customers. Users with an active Volume Licensing (VL) agreement can access the Microsoft 365 admin center and download their products as ISO image files. An ISO downloaded from this official portal is considered a legitimate first-party distribution method. For the vast majority of home users and small businesses, however, this isn't an option, and seeking out an ISO from any other source is a significant security risk.
